Senior Vision Systems Developer | Embedded C++/FPGA | Advanced Defense Tech
Shape the Future of Situational Awareness in the Defense Sector
We are looking for a Senior Vision Systems Developer to take technical ownership of end-to-end imaging solutions for high-end military equipment and battle vehicle systems. If you are an expert in Embedded C++ and FPGA, and you understand what happens between a sensor’s RAW output and a crystal-clear display, this role is for you.
The Mission: You will be responsible for the "eyes" of modern tactical platforms. Your work will cover the entire pipeline: from capturing RAW data from high-performance sensors to real-time image processing and system-wide communication.
Key Responsibilities:
End-to-End Integration: Develop and integrate cameras for advanced vision systems used in harsh military environments.
Image Processing: Implement and optimize algorithms for "daily vision" (LUTs, 3DLUTs, De-Bayering, color transformation, and filter kernels).
Hardware-Software Bridging: Bridge the gap between software and hardware by managing communication with FPGA modules.
Driver & Protocol Development: Work with low-level interfaces such as MIPI-CSI2 and PCI to ensure high-speed, low-latency data flow.
What We Are Looking For:
5+ years of experience in Embedded C/C++ development.
FPGA Expertise: Hands-on experience with FPGA modules and their communication protocols.
Vision Systems Specialist: Proven track record in image grabbing, data flow management, and sensor integration.
Advanced Imaging Knowledge: Deep understanding of concepts like gamma, gain, filter kernels, and RAW image processing.
Platform Versatility: Experience developing for multiple platforms, specifically Linux-based embedded systems.
Protocol Proficiency: Strong knowledge of MIPI-CSI2 and PCI.
Nice to have:
Experience with Allied Vision Alvium series cameras (CSI-2 interface, register controls, and V-SWIR sensors).
Why Apply?
Impact: Work on technology that directly enhances the safety and effectiveness of personnel in the field.
Complexity: Tackle unique technical challenges involving high-speed data and complex image processing.
Innovation: Use industry-leading sensors and cutting-edge hardware.
Senior Vision Systems Developer | Embedded C++/FPGA | Advanced Defense Tech
Senior Vision Systems Developer | Embedded C++/FPGA | Advanced Defense Tech